Yin Collection, Middle Volume Radical: Mountain (shān) Huan Page 310, Entry 37 Broad Rhymes (Guangyun), Collected Rhymes (Jiyun), Rhyme Meetings (Yunhui), and Correct Rhymes (Zhengyun): Pronounced huan. Also pronounced heng. Same meaning. Literary Expositor (Erya), Explanation of Mountains: A small mountain that is higher than a large mountain is called huan. Commentary: Xing Bing says: When a small mountain and a large mountain are adjacent, and the small mountain is higher than the large mountain, it is called huan. Collected Rhymes (Jiyun): Sometimes also written in a variant form.
